Hi! I am Michelle, a Licensed Aesthetician, here today to give you some tips and techniques for waxing at home.

Tips for How to Wax at Home

The most important part to waxing at home is following the kit directions. Whatever the instructions say at home, follow those to the tee. You're going to place the wax with the lid off in the microwave.

Waxing at Home

The second step you're going to want to do is to clean the area. This is very important, if you're doing your face like we are today, you're going to want to make sure to remove any makeup from the area. Removing the makeup from the area will allow the wax to adhere closer to the hair and remove it. As you will most likely be doing this on yourself, you can take the wax after it is done with the microwave and apply a skin test right here on your forearm. This will allow you to make sure you do not burn your face or any other area that you're waxing. The wax needs to be hot, but not to an uncomfortable degree.

After you've cleaned the area, make sure to pat the area gently dry. You're going to want to take your tongue depressor or stick and mix the wax with it. Once you get a sufficient amount on the stick, you want to twirl it around, so you don't have any dripping. This will all allow it to cool off, so it does not burn your skin. Once you have your wax ready, you want to pull the skin tightly and apply to the wanted area. Before you get the wax ready, you're going to want to look at your brows and be prepared and ready for the shape and type you want.
